From b6239823fba189e7c1bd518dd8121a934c240a61 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Guy Turcotte Date: Mon, 28 Jan 2019 18:02:37 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] Allow streaming of large messages These changes are required to allow for the transmission of large messages through a connected stream. The changes do not have an impact on the class interface and habitual behavior. In particular, it will enable the use of OTA through a stream hooked through the setStream() class method.
